| career roles | key responsibilities |
|---|---|
| plant cloning specialist | developing cloning protocols, ensuring genetic consistency, maintaining sterile environments |
| agricultural biotechnologist | researching plant genetics, optimizing cloning techniques, improving crop yields |
| tissue culture technician | preparing culture media, monitoring plant growth, troubleshooting contamination issues |
| horticultural consultant | advising on cloning applications, designing propagation strategies, ensuring regulatory compliance |
| research scientist | conducting experiments, publishing findings, collaborating with agricultural institutions |
